The sea no longer calls the way it once did. After fire, loss, and years spent chasing storms, Nikki has finally come home. The Hearthsong Tavern stands warm once more, its hearth lit not by magic or destiny, but by choice-and by love. Alongside Maris, whose strength has always been quieter than the blade she carries, Nikki begins to rebuild a life shaped by memory rather than battle. Together they welcome a new beginning in the form of Cecelia-a bright-eyed girl with mint-green hair, an unruly violin, and a laugh that fills the tavern faster than any song. In the gentle rhythm of shared meals, mended walls, and evenings spent by the fire, the past lingers like embers beneath the ash. Yet healing is never simple. Grief still breathes in old corners, and the fire Nikki once carried has not entirely faded-it has merely changed. The Hearth That Held Us is a story about what remains after the flame: about chosen family, quiet courage, and the strength it takes to stay. A soft fantasy tale of love, growth, and the magic found in ordinary days.
